I am having trouble with my EasySEt pool staying level. It sinks or becomes unlevel on one side. Please give advice on how to prepare the site before I put my pool up again. (I have drained it again). It is a 15' on bermuda grass in Arkansas. Thanks

Hi I have a splasher above ground pool.

I had to remove all the grass and then level the ground by digging out ,not filling up.
I then ensured that all soil was compact ,added a layer of sand to protect
the liner and then put the pool up.I have also read of people using a concrete base to ensure the pool is level and no subsidence.

The main recommendations for bases are:

1) The ground that you are putting it on is level.
2) The ground you are putting it on is Soild & well compacted.

We always recommend that the larger pools go on a concrete based just due to the weight of water inside the pool.
